Overview of Smart Roofing Technology

Smart roofing technology refers to the integration of advanced materials, sensors, and systems into roofing structures to enhance performance, efficiency, and sustainability. By incorporating smart elements, roofs can actively respond to environmental conditions, improve energy efficiency, and even communicate data for monitoring and maintenance purposes.Some examples of smart roofing technology in modern buildings include:

  • Solar panels integrated into roofing materials to generate renewable energy.
  • Cool roofs designed to reflect sunlight and reduce heat absorption, lowering cooling costs.
  • Green roofs with vegetation to improve insulation, reduce stormwater runoff, and enhance aesthetics.
  • Smart sensors that monitor temperature, humidity, and structural integrity, providing real-time data for optimal roof management.

The benefits of implementing smart roofing technology are numerous:

  • Energy savings through improved insulation, solar energy generation, and reduced cooling needs.
  • Extended roof lifespan due to proactive monitoring and maintenance enabled by sensors.
  • Enhanced comfort and indoor air quality by regulating temperature and humidity levels.
  • Environmental benefits such as reduced carbon footprint and stormwater management.
  • Increased property value and marketability with sustainable and efficient roofing solutions.

Components of Smart Roofing Systems

Smart roofing systems consist of various key components that work together to enhance the overall performance of the roof. Each component plays a crucial role in ensuring the efficiency and functionality of the system.

Solar Panels

Solar panels are an essential component of smart roofing systems as they harness sunlight to generate electricity. These panels are typically installed on the roof to capture solar energy and convert it into usable power for the building.

Sensors

Sensors are used to monitor various environmental factors such as temperature, humidity, and weather conditions. These sensors provide real-time data to the smart roofing system, allowing it to adjust and optimize its performance accordingly.

Smart Shingles

Smart shingles are innovative roofing materials embedded with technology that can regulate temperature, provide insulation, and even generate electricity. These shingles are designed to improve energy efficiency and overall sustainability of the roof.

Data Analytics Software

Data analytics software processes the information collected by sensors and other components to provide insights and recommendations for optimizing the smart roofing system. This software helps in making informed decisions to improve the performance of the roof.

Advancements in Smart Roofing Technology

Recent innovations in smart roofing technology have revolutionized the way roofs function, offering improved efficiency and sustainability.

New Materials for Improved Efficiency

New materials such as solar shingles, cool roofs, and green roofs are being used to enhance the efficiency of smart roofs. Solar shingles, for example, integrate solar cells into traditional roofing materials, allowing for energy generation while maintaining a sleek appearance.

Cool roofs are designed to reflect more sunlight and absorb less heat, reducing the need for air conditioning. Green roofs utilize vegetation to provide insulation, absorb rainwater, and reduce urban heat island effects.

Enhanced Sustainability and Environmental Friendliness

  • Advancements in smart roofing systems are making them more sustainable by reducing energy consumption and carbon emissions.
  • The use of recycled materials in smart roofs is also becoming more prevalent, further contributing to environmental friendliness.
  • Smart roofs with integrated sensors and automation systems can optimize energy usage and minimize waste, leading to a more environmentally conscious approach to roofing.

Integration of IoT in Smart Roofing

The Internet of Things (IoT) plays a crucial role in enhancing smart roofing technology by enabling the connection and communication of various devices and sensors within the roofing system.

Examples of IoT Integration in Smart Roofing

  • IoT-enabled moisture sensors can be installed in smart roofs to detect leaks or water damage in real-time, sending alerts to homeowners or building managers.
  • Smart thermostats integrated with IoT technology can regulate temperature settings based on weather conditions, optimizing energy efficiency.
  • IoT-connected cameras can provide live footage of the roof, allowing for remote monitoring and surveillance for security purposes.

Benefits of IoT Connectivity in Smart Roofs

  • Remote Monitoring: IoT connectivity allows users to monitor the status of their roof in real-time from anywhere, providing peace of mind and early detection of potential issues.
  • Energy Efficiency: By utilizing IoT devices to control heating and cooling systems, smart roofs can optimize energy usage and reduce utility costs.
  • Data Collection and Analysis: IoT sensors collect data on various environmental factors affecting the roof, enabling informed decision-making and proactive maintenance.

Energy Efficiency and Cost Savings

Smart roofing technology plays a crucial role in enhancing energy efficiency and reducing costs for building owners. By integrating advanced features and components, smart roofs help in optimizing energy consumption and promoting sustainability.

Energy Efficiency Benefits

  • Improved Insulation: Smart roofing systems are designed to enhance insulation, reducing heat loss during winter and minimizing heat gain during summer. This results in lower energy usage for heating and cooling.
  • Solar Energy Utilization: Some smart roofs are equipped with solar panels or solar shingles that harness renewable energy from the sun, reducing reliance on traditional energy sources
    .
  • Energy Monitoring and Management: Smart roofing technology often includes sensors and monitoring devices that track energy usage in real-time. This data can help building owners optimize energy consumption and identify areas for improvement.

Smart roofing technology plays a significant role in improving the maintenance and durability of roofs. By utilizing advanced sensors and monitoring systems, smart roofs can detect issues early, preventing small problems from turning into costly repairs.

Improved Maintenance

  • Smart roofs can continuously monitor the condition of the roof, detecting leaks, cracks, or other issues in real-time.
  • Alert systems can notify homeowners or building managers immediately when maintenance or repairs are needed, allowing for prompt action.
  • Regular maintenance checks can be automated, ensuring that small problems are addressed before they escalate.

Enhanced Durability

  • Smart roofing materials are often more durable and resistant to weather elements compared to traditional roofing systems, prolonging the lifespan of the roof.
  • Advanced coatings and sealants used in smart roofs can provide better protection against UV rays, moisture, and other damaging factors.
  • Smart roofs are designed to withstand extreme weather conditions, reducing the risk of damage during storms or natural disasters.

Best Practices for Maintenance

  • Regularly inspect the roof for any signs of damage, such as loose shingles, cracks, or leaks.
  • Clean debris and leaves from the roof to prevent clogging of drainage systems and water pooling.
  • Schedule annual inspections by professional roofers to identify and address any potential issues early on.
  • Follow manufacturer's guidelines for maintenance and cleaning of smart roofing systems to ensure optimal performance and longevity.

Environmental Impact of Smart Roofing Technology

Smart roofing technology plays a crucial role in promoting environmental sustainability and reducing the carbon footprint in the construction industry. By integrating intelligent systems into roofs, various environmental benefits can be achieved.

Reduced Energy Consumption

Smart roofs help in reducing energy consumption by regulating indoor temperatures more efficiently. By utilizing sensors and automated controls, these roofs can adjust ventilation, heating, and cooling systems based on real-time data, leading to lower energy usage and reduced greenhouse gas emissions.

Stormwater Management

Smart roofing systems are designed to effectively manage stormwater runoff, reducing the strain on municipal drainage systems and preventing water pollution. These roofs can collect and store rainwater for reuse, promoting water conservation and minimizing the impact of urban development on local ecosystems.

Enhanced Air Quality

Through the use of green roofing technologies integrated with smart features, such as air filtration systems and pollutant sensors, smart roofs contribute to improving air quality in urban areas. By filtering pollutants and capturing particulate matter, these roofs help create healthier environments for building occupants and surrounding communities.

Alignment with Green Building Standards

Smart roofing technology aligns with green building standards and certifications, such as LEED (Leadership in Energy and Environmental Design) and Energy Star. By meeting the criteria set forth by these programs, buildings with smart roofs can achieve higher levels of sustainability, energy efficiency, and environmental performance.

Long-Term Sustainability

The durability and longevity of smart roofing systems contribute to long-term sustainability by reducing the need for frequent roof replacements and minimizing construction waste. These roofs are designed to withstand environmental challenges and extreme weather conditions, ensuring continued protection for the building and the environment.

Future Trends and Predictions

As smart roofing technology continues to advance, there are several key trends and predictions that experts believe will shape the future of this industry.

Increased Integration with Renewable Energy Sources

One of the most significant trends expected in the future of smart roofing technology is the increased integration with renewable energy sources. Smart roofs are likely to become even more efficient at harnessing solar power and other renewable energy forms, contributing to a more sustainable and eco-friendly built environment.

Enhanced Connectivity and Automation

In the coming years, smart roofs are predicted to become more interconnected and automated. This means that these systems will be able to communicate with other smart devices in a building, optimizing energy usage, and providing real-time data for improved efficiency and performance.

Innovations in Materials and Design

Future advancements in smart roofing technology are expected to bring about innovations in materials and design. From self-healing materials to customizable designs that blend seamlessly with the aesthetics of a building, the future of smart roofs holds exciting possibilities for both functionality and aesthetics.
